Miso Soup Low Carb Miso Soup Recipe With Salmon

Peel the Daikon and cut into quarters lengthwise and slice thinly. Cut salmon into bite size pieces. Bring dashi to a boil, and cook the Daikon and salmon in dashi for 5 minutes covered at medium low heat. Turn off the heat and dissolve miso. Serve in a bowl and top with chopped green onion.

Salmon Miso Soup Andrea Beaman

Instructions. Put 600ml water from the kettle into a saucepan. Add the miso, ginger and garlic and bring back to the boil. Lower the salmon gently into the water and simmer until the salmon is just cooked and begins to flake when you touch it with a fork. It'll take about 5 minutes.
